Ho Sakta Hai
Ho Sakta Hai is a 2006 Indian horror film directed by Wilson Louis and produced by Ashok Kotwani. The film stars Khalid Siddiqui, Hazel Crowney, and Victor Banerjee. It follows a family living peacefully until they discover that they are falling prey to black magic.
The film was screened at several international film festivals but was a box office bomb in India.

Critical reviews
Taran Adarsh of Bollywood Hungama rated the film 1.5 out of 5, praising the performances of Victor Banerjee, Khalid Siddiqui, and Hazel Crowney.Joginder Tuteja of IndiaGlitz praised the visual effects of the film.
Parbina Rashid of The Tribune highlighted the performances of Banerjee and Mohini.
Accolades
Ho Sakta Hai was screened at the Cannes Film Festival in 2005 and the Filmpur Film Festival in England the same year. The film was nominated as one of the Best Three Films at the FICCI Awards.
